Wednesday is cleaning day for chisokone

- By SIABANA KELVIN

KITWE City Council has devoted every Wednesday of the week as a general cleaning day for Chisokone Market.

This is to avert the further spread of cholera which also spread to Kitwe from Lusaka where the disease initially broke out.

The exercise would be conducted between 06 hrs and 10hrs to make the market clean and conducive for marketeers and other traders.

Kitwe Town Clerk Bornwell Luanga noted that Kitwe was the economic and mining hub of Zambia adding that Chisokone Market should be a shining example to other big markets in the country in terms of cleanlines­s.

Mr. Luanga said the market was one of the biggest on the Copperbelt hence the need for traders and other marketeers to conduct their businesses in an area which had acceptable hy- giene standards for the benefit of their customers.

The Town clerk said the Council would engage the marketeers and other partners in the city to ensure that they got involved in the cleaning exercise every Wednesday before starting their businesses so that they could trade in a clean environmen­t.

"I’m urging the marketeers and other traders at Chisokone market not to shun the general cleaning day because it is a very important day for everyone," said Mr Luanga.

The town clerk appealed to the marketeers to be vigilant and report anyone who would be found throwing litter anyhow at the market to the local authority.

Mr Luanga has also advised the residents of Kitwe not to buy fresh food products on the streets such as meat, fish and others in order to prevent the further spread of cholera in the mining city.
